Show Jumping Meets Eventing This Week at Land Rover Kentucky Three-Day Event

Thursday, April 26th marks the first day of competition for the Land Rover Kentucky Three-Day Event held at the beautiful Kentucky Horse Park in Lexington, Kentucky. This legendary event draws in competitors and fans alike from all across the globe for fierce competition, excellent shopping and a sense of community unlike no other.

And the Best Weekend All Year just got even better.

This year the Split Rocking Jumping Tour and Equestrian Events INC (host of Land Rover) paired up to offer international show jumping competition throughout the week as well. We summed up all the details for you HERE.

Friday kicks off with a 1.45m speed class in the Rolex arena starting at 6PM. On Saturday the First Horse $225,000 Kentucky Invitational CSI3* 1.60m will begin at 4:30PM and is bound to be a highlight of the weekend.

So who can you see challenging this Saturday’s CSI3* show jumping competition? There are 30 riders listed on the Split Rocking Jumping Tour’s Show Grounds Live site including big names such as Aaron Vale, Marilyn Little, Darragh Kenny, Karl Cook, Eve Jobs and Scott Keach.
